Constructed in the year 1938, this Art Deco-style theater originally served as a movie-house during Miami Beach's heyday. Its architect, Robert E. Collins, designed it with an eye for opulence and modish appeal that would become its trademark. Over the years, however, the theater evolved into a prime spot for live performances, featuring a variety of shows, ranging from concerts and stand-up comedy acts to theatrical productions and dance performances.

Beyond the tangible architecture and performances, the Cameo Theater embodies the legacy of stars who have graced its stage throughout the years. Music legends such as Pearl Jam, Red Hot Chili Peppers, and Erykah Badu have all commanded a presence here, leaving their footprints on the theater's historic legacy.
